My Mishawaka home was built around 1975. Do I need lead or asbestos testing before water-damaged materials are removed?

Yes. The EPA Renovation, Repair, and Painting (RRP) Rule mandates testing for lead in any home built before 1978. For asbestos, the cutoff is 1989, but structures from the 1970s have a high probability of containing asbestos in materials like vinyl flooring, pipe wrap, or popcorn ceilings. The Mishawaka City Building Department requires compliance with these rules. Demolition of regulated materials without proper containment and certified abatement is a federal violation.

How quickly do I need to act on a water leak to prevent mold in my Mishawaka home?

You have a 48–72 hour window from the initial intrusion to begin professional mitigation. After this mold growth window, microbial amplification becomes likely. As of 2026, insurance carriers and courts increasingly consider delayed response a failure in the 'standard of care,' which can shift liability and complicate claim approval. Immediate action to control humidity and begin drying is non-negotiable.

If a surface in my Downtown Mishawaka home feels dry to the touch, is it actually dry?

No. 'Dry to the touch' refers to surface moisture only. Structural drying is governed by psychrometrics—the physics of air and moisture. The IICRC S500 standard of care requires restoring the cavity air to a dry standard of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Achieving this correct vapor pressure equilibrium is critical to prevent secondary damage in Downtown's older building assemblies, where trapped moisture is common.

What is the first thing I should do while waiting for a restoration crew to arrive at my home near Beutter Park?

Your first action is loss mitigation: safely stop the water source. Locate and turn off the main water shut-off valve. If electrical safety is a concern, shut off power at the breaker panel for the affected area. This rapid response limits 'loss of use' and prevents the water category from escalating (e.g., from clean to gray water), which directly impacts claim complexity and restoration costs. Then, move contents to a dry area if safe to do so.

What's the difference between 'Clean,' 'Gray,' and 'Black' water in an insurance claim, and how can I lower my premium?

Category 1 ('Clean') water is from a sanitary source. Your policy notes a Category 2 ('Gray') water hazard, which contains significant contamination and requires antimicrobial treatment. Category 3 ('Black') water is grossly contaminated, like sewage. Installing IoT leak sensors (e.g., Moen Flo) can provide a 5-8% premium credit discount in Indiana, as they enable automatic shut-off, drastically reducing the volume and category of water loss, which simplifies claims and limits damage.
